The Problem of Lost Keys and the Bluetooth Tracker Solution
Forgetting where you put your keys, wallet, or even an umbrella can lead to wasted time and added stress. Bluetooth trackers are designed to alleviate this problem by allowing users to locate their belongings using a smartphone app. These small devices attach to items and communicate with your phone via Bluetooth. If an item is within range, you can often trigger a sound from the tracker or view its last known location on a map.

Key Features and Performance
- Loud Audible Alert: A standout feature of the FineTrack Duo is its volume. Ugreen claims an 80dB-100dB output, which is significantly louder than the Apple AirTag’s reported 60dB. This increased loudness is crucial when trying to locate an item that is not immediately visible, even from a distance within a home.
- Cross-Platform Compatibility: Unlike some trackers that are tied to specific ecosystems, the FineTrack Duo supports both iOS and Android devices. This versatility makes it a more adaptable choice, especially when purchasing for multiple users or as a gift, as it doesn’t require the recipient to own a particular brand of smartphone.
- USB-C Charging: The tracker utilizes a USB-C port for charging, a modern standard that eliminates the need for disposable button-cell batteries. This offers convenience and a more sustainable approach to power management. The battery is rated to last for approximately one year on a single charge.
- Integration with Find Networks: The FineTrack Duo can be located using either Apple’s Find My network or Google’s Find My Device network, depending on the model purchased or configured. This leverages existing, expansive networks of devices to help locate items even when they are out of direct Bluetooth range.
- ‘Lost Mode’ Functionality: Similar to other advanced trackers, the FineTrack Duo offers a ‘Lost Mode.’ When activated, users can input their contact information, which can then be accessed by anyone who finds the lost item, facilitating its return.
Value Proposition and Comparisons
At a price point that can fall to just over AU$10 per unit when purchased in multi-packs, the Ugreen FineTrack Duo presents a compelling value proposition. This cost-effectiveness is a major draw, especially when contrasted with the higher price of premium trackers. The inclusion of a built-in keyring loop and the louder sound output further enhance its practical utility, addressing common pain points associated with key loss.
While the FineTrack Duo offers broad compatibility, it’s worth noting that specific versions might be optimized for either iOS or Android. However, the ‘Duo’ designation often implies dual compatibility or a bundle that caters to both. The charging port, while convenient, is protected by a dust plug that is not tethered, posing a minor risk of being misplaced itself.
